JOB SUMMARY

This position contributes to Sanctuary's success by providing superior guest service that will exceed guest and employees' expectations during their experience ordering In-Room Dining service. In this position it will be highly important to both efficiently and accurately take orders. A focus on living the Sanctuary Commitments and our Promise of Care Enough to do it well is critical to the success of this position as a Sanctuary community member.

JOB FUNCTIONS

Note: the following duties and responsibilities are not all-inclusive

  • Take all guest Room Service orders, hand-write /record order with specifications listed, repeat order back to guest. Ring the order into the computer immediately after finishing the conservation with the guest.

  • Communicate with Private Bar attendant throughout the day with any rooms that have checked out.

  • Monitor HOTSOS, Traces in Opera, and Guest Arrivals.

  • Place the handwritten order, the check, and the pick-up card in the check presenter for the server.

  • If timing allows assist in preparing the order and anything that will increase the efficiency of the expedition of the server's deliveries of the orders, amenities, and any other needs for the In Room Dining Team.

  • Follow the order procedures for all amenities, coordinate all deliveries, and ensure tracking slips are filled out for any amenity over $50.

  • Communicate any discrepancies to supervisor who will follow up with the department/person.

  • Coordinate orders and communicate well with servers to ensure timely service.

  • Staple the order forms to the computer slips and drop them at the end of the shift according to accounting procedures.

  • If a guest calls down to have a tray picked up, quote the guest time for pick-up accurately within a 10 min window +/- 5 minutes of quoted pick-up time.

  • Side work is done according to posted assignments; assist servers with side work during down time.

  • Maintain a positive work atmosphere by acting and communicating in a manner that enables getting along with guests, vendors, co-workers, and management.

  • Desk is to be organized, neat and clean at all times. Keep computer and phones clean.

  • Ensure there is enough paper/office supplies at all times.

  • Ensure professional environment. Noise level should be kept to a minimum. Follow proper telephone etiquette and departmental policies and procedures.

  • Whenever a break is needed, ensure that another trained staff member is answering phone calls.

  • If a guest calls for information or services other than In Room Dining (bathrobe, shaving cream, etc.) quickly and politely assists guest by calling the appropriate department. A guest should only need to call one number for any request. Follow up with guest to ensure satisfaction.

  • If a guest calls to order amenities, cakes or flowers, fill out the appropriate form and follow appropriate procedures by informing all departments involved.

  • Perform additional duties as requested by the Room Service Manager, supervisor of F&B Manager.
